코드 작성룰, 이클립스 단축키, 변수선언
데이터 타입의 변환 '자동 변환' , '강제 변환' : casting
자바, 연산, 연산자, 증감 연산, 대입 연산, 복합 연산, 관계 연산, 논리 연산, 삼항 연산, 문자열 연결
자바, 조건문 ( If, else, else if, Switch )
자바, 반복문 ( for, while, do while, break, continue )
자바, 배열, Array, 1차원배열
자바, 배열, 2차원 배열
향상된 for문, advanced for문
인수, 파라미터
메소드 오버로딩 ( OverLoading )
자바 말 줄임표(ellipsis)
return 반환
void 메소드의 return(반환)
계산기 클래스(설계도), 자바독(자바 도큐먼트 : 자바 문서) 만드는 법
자바, 클래스, 객체 만들기
자바, 클래스, 필드 ( Field )
자바, 클래스, 접근 제어 지시자( Access Modifier )
자바, 인스턴스( instance ) , 인스턴스멤버, 클래스멤버
자바, 상속, Inheritance, is a 관계, has a 관계
자바 상속 " is a 관계 " 에 이어서 두 번째 관계 " has a 관계 "
자바, 상속 : 상속 관계의 생성자
자바 메소드 오버라이드(Override)
자바, 클래스, 업캐스팅 upcasting
자바, 클래스, 다운캐스팅, downcasting
자바, Object 클래스, equals (동일한 객체끼리 비교)
자바, abstract, 추상, 추상 클래스, 추상 메소드
자바, 인터페이스, Interface
Generic , 데이터 형식에 의존하지 않고, 하나의 값이 여러 다른 데이터 타입들을 가질 수 있도록 하는 방법
자바, ArrayList
자바, Set, 반복자, Iterator, hash
자바, map, hashmap
자바, API
자바, API, StringBuffer, StringBuilder , 문자열 연결
자바, API, Random, MathRandom, SecureRandom, UUID
자바, Exception, 예외 처리, try-catch , throw , finally , throws
자바, 인풋, 아웃풋, Input, Output
자바, OutputStream